Mesothelioma Lawsuits

A lawyer will determine the companies responsible for you exposure and file a suit. After the filing, defendants have a set amount of time to respond.

The compensation you receive from a mesothelioma lawsuit can aid you and your family members pay for medical bills and lost wages. In addition, settlements may include compensation for pain and suffering.

Damages

A successful mesothelioma case could result in a substantial compensation payout. This compensation is meant to help victims deal with the financial burdens that come with this condition. These damages can include medical costs as well as lost wages, suffering and pain.

Mesothelioma patients can receive compensation from three sources: VA benefits for veterans with mesothelioma, compensation from asbestos trust funds, and an award or settlement from their asbestos lawsuit. Mesothelioma settlements are more frequent than trial verdicts, but each case is different and could benefit from trials in certain cases.

Asbestos victims often must fight for fair compensation, and the trial process can take years before a verdict is reached. Trials are a way to get a higher payout and hold asbestos-related companies accountable in court.

The litigation process involves the discovery phase, during which both parties exchange information and take depositions. This aids in building their case. In a mesothelioma-related case asbestos companies can be held liable for punitive damage awards. These are awarded when there is fraud or malicious intent on the part of the defendant. These additional damages can make a an important difference to the victim's quality of life as well as their family's finances.

Medical expenses can quickly pile up for mesothelioma sufferers. In addition, they typically are not able to work due to their mesothelioma symptoms, leading to an income loss. A mesothelioma trial verdict or settlement could grant victims the money they need to cover these costs and also take care of their families.

In certain states, such as New York, the statute of limitations for filing mesothelioma lawsuits is two years from the date of diagnosis or at the time of death for wrongful death suits. It is crucial to file your claim as soon as you can.

Settlements

A mesothelioma lawsuit seeks compensation from the companies that are responsible for asbestos exposure. Compensation can help patients and their families pay for medical bills, funeral expenses, lost income and other expenses. Asbestos victims can also be awarded damages for their pain and suffering. The lawsuit could also award punitive damages to penalize defendants for negligence and discourage similar behavior.

Asbestos victims often receive settlements in the millions of dollars. The amount of money paid will depend on the specific case, as many factors can affect the final amount. The number of defendants, as an example can affect the settlement amount.

The severity of the disease and the cause of it will also determine the amount of compensation given to the victim or their family. Asbestos cancers like mesothelioma, tend to be more serious and life-threatening than non-cancerous diseases like asbestosis. Defense lawyers often settle rather than take an action to trial because of the chance of losing in court. A mesothelioma case can still be brought to trial by the client if they wish to. A mesothelioma lawyer can provide expert witnesses for their clients in the case of a court trial.

The verdicts at trial can be higher than settlements for mesothelioma since jurors can make a higher verdict if the defendant is negligent. However, verdicts cannot be guaranteed and they can be reduced by a private agreement or by appeals court.

Before the settlement can be reached in a mesothelioma suit, there may need to be several rounds of mediation and negotiations. During this process attorneys and defense attorneys will exchange documents and conduct depositions with witnesses (written or in person interviews). The family members who survived can file a lawsuit for the wrongful death of a deceased person died of mesothelioma, or another asbestos-related illness. Family members include spouses siblings, children parents, grandchildren and grandparents. The estate of the victim can also file a suit for mesothelioma-related mesothelioma wrongful and their beneficiaries or representative.

The majority of mesothelioma lawsuits stem on personal injuries. They make the asbestos company accountable and hold them liable.

While asbestos exposure is the most frequent mesothelioma cause, a lot of people were exposed to secondhand asbestos. This includes wives that washed their husbands' uniforms or shook off his work clothes and neighbors of asbestos workers.
